Digital Technologies HR And Payroll Portfolio Manager

Are you looking for a role that makes an impact across the entire company? Are you excited about driving transformation with our HR functional partners? Then this is the job for you!

RTX Enterprise Services (ES) is looking for a highly motivated, business-focused Digital Technologies (DT) HR and Payroll Portfolio Manager to join our Enterprise Services Applications (ES-Apps) Value Management Office (VMO). The role of the portfolio manager is to ensure successful planning and execution of projects that deliver value to our customers. These projects span the RTX businesses, Corporate Functions, and Enterprise Services, supporting both Enterprise as well as business-specific solutions. This position will be responsible for our portfolio of projects in the Human Resource and Payroll areas. They will have project managers reporting directly to them and make resource assignments to satisfy demand. The portfolio manager will work in partnership with our Service Lines to manage initiatives through the project lifecycle. Responsibilities include reporting on health of the portfolio, managing escalated risks and issues, ensuring proper phase-gate rigor, and holding portfolio reviews with various stakeholders. The portfolio manager demonstrates ownership of the portfolio and its ultimate success!

What You Will Do :

  • Utilize and improve portfolio management processes, tools, and RTX governance framework.
  • Align the project portfolio with RTX's strategic objectives.
  • Track the performance of all projects in the portfolio, ensuring timelines, budgets, and quality standards are met.
  • Generate and deliver portfolio reporting and status updates to senior leadership.
  • Identify trends, risks, and opportunities across the portfolio and make recommendations for improvement.
  • Manage the allocation of project management resources across projects to optimize capacity and reduce conflicts.
  • Facilitate regular portfolio review meetings with key stakeholders.
  • Drive process improvements across the project management lifecycle.
  • Mentor and support project managers in following best practices and standardized methodologies.

Qualifications You Must Have :

  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Information Technology, Engineering, or related field (Master's degree preferred) with 12+ years of experience in project management, with at least 2 years in a portfolio or program management role.
  • Experience with the HR and Payroll functions with proven ability to manage multiple complex projects and portfolios.
  • Proficiency with PPM tools such as Microsoft Project, Planview, or similar platforms.
  • Strong understanding of project management methodologies (Agile, Waterfall, Hybrid) and excellent organ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ills.
  • Demonstrated leadership, communication, and stakeholder management abilities.
  • Qualifications We Prefer :

  • Experience in a PMO or strategic planning role is highly desirable.
  • PMP, PgMP, or PfMP certification is a plus.
